Methodology Tools

The CRGC uses the following methodology tools to develop and adapt CPGs.

Grading of Recommendations Assessment, Development and Evaluation (GRADE)

The CTS uses the GRADE methodology to evaluate the quality of evidence and the strength of the recommendation for each respiratory guideline.

Appraisal of Guideline Research and Evaluation (AGREE)

The CTS uses the AGREE Instrument to systematically assess key components of the respiratory guidelines to ensure they meet the highest standard of quality.

Guideline Implementation Appraisal (GLIA)

The CTS uses GLIA to assess the how readily respiratory guidelines can be implemented in order to predict any potential challenges.

ADAPTE

The CTS uses the ADAPTE framework for the adaptation of respiratory guidelines that were not originally produced by CTS.
